To provide a column base capable of suppressing or preventing cleavage of a foundation of a building without being limited by an attachment position to the foundation of the building.SOLUTION: A column base 10 includes: a column 30 disposed on an upper face of a foundation portion 14, extending in a building vertical direction, and constituting a part of a skeleton of a building 12; a base plate 32 disposed at a lower end portion of the column 30, having a plate thickness direction that is the building vertical direction, and formed to be substantially flat plate shape; a fixing portion 34 formed to be substantially flat plate shape outwardly from an outer peripheral portion of the base plate 32 along a face direction of the base plate 32; and a setting plate 42 which is fixed at a building lower side of the base plate 32 on an upper face of the foundation portion 14 so that a corner portion 42B is positioned at an end portion of the foundation portion 14, which is formed to be substantially flat plate shape with a plate thickness direction that is the building vertical direction, and in which a tilted portion 46 tilted from an inside of a lower face toward the corner portion 42B and a building upper side is formed.SELECTED DRAWING: Figure 2B
